The Ocean’s Operating System: The Mechanisms, Materials, and Rules Driving Marine Planktonic Life
Calbet, Albert (Institute of Marine Sciences, CSIC, Barcelona)
This mechanism-first guide to how the sea actually works teaches the rules—light, viscosity, turbulence, temperature, oxygen, pressure, and elemental budgets—and the devices organisms use to play by them: filters and houses, pellets and gels, pigments and transporters, migrations and dormancy.
